Abstract
I agree with Prof. Liang about the desirability of plotting F2-layer critical frequencies with magnetic latitude rather than with magnetic dip. In an article in Science, p. 17, July 4, 1947, I have given such a plot, which, for noon values of equinox critical frequency, shows two sharp maxima at ±18° magnetic latitude. The high midnight values of F2-layer critical frequency at stations on the geomagnetic equator are also attributed to the low electron recombination which is associated with the marked bifurcation of the F2-layer into the F1 and F2 strata.
